Handover note — Crumbwheel order cutoffs.

Welcome aboard. The bakery cutoff rule in Crumbwheel closes same-day orders at 14:00 local to each storefront, not UTC — this has bitten us twice. Holiday overrides live in the calendar service and take precedence silently, so always check there first when a cutoff looks wrong. To unlock the calendar service's admin console after a restart, enter the recovery passphrase below.

vault phrase of bagap-bahaf = silion-pelox-sorox-casdor-quenwyn-fraax-eliox-praael-kelion-quenvan-kasox-rusael-norius-belvan

Subject: DR Drill — Locale Service Cutover (Date Formatting)

Hello plugin authors,

Next Tuesday, Tindermark will run a disaster-recovery drill on the Calverno locale service. During the window, date-format lookups will be served from the Eastwick standby. Plugins should fall back to ISO 8601 if a locale pattern is unavailable; do not cache region-specific formats across the drill. If your sandbox tenant becomes sealed during cutover, restore access with the phrase given just below.

recovery phrase for bajog-kadug: lamion-novdor-oliix-belox-nordor-praeth-sorael

## Session Handling for Health Checks

The Corvel gateway sits behind the Lanternside load balancer, which probes /healthz every ten seconds. Health-check requests are stateless by design: they bypass the session store entirely so that probe traffic never inflates session counts or evicts real user sessions. New team members should note that the deep-check endpoint, /healthz/deep, does verify session-store connectivity and therefore requires authentication. When probing it manually, supply the token below.

bearer token for tajep-kajef: eyJhbGciOiJIUzI1NiIsInR5cCI6IkpXVCJ9.eyJzdWIiOiIoOsZ23In0.CsygO0hs

## Tuning

We moved the old nightly cron jobs into Drift, our workflow engine, so retries and backoff are now config-driven instead of buried in shell scripts. Good news: no more 3 a.m. pages for silent failures. Less-good news: if retry budgets are too generous, jobs pile up behind each other. Keep an eye on queue depth after deploys. The current retry and scheduling constants are listed below.

tuning table, yajog-yahof:
BUDGETS = {
    "lamvan": 303,
    "wenox": 460,
    "fenvan": 525,
}